zoukankan      html  css  js  c++  java
  • 一段测试try...catch运行时间的代码

    public class Test2 {

        private static int test() {
            int i=1;

            try {
                i=2;
                return i;
            } catch (Exception e) {
                i = 3;
                return i;
            } finally {
                i = 4;
                System.out.println(i);
            }
           
        }

        public static void main(String[] args){
         double b = 0;
         String s = "";
         long ii = System.currentTimeMillis();
            for(int i = 0; i<20000;i++) {
             try {
              b = StrictMath.pow(b+i, 1.0/3);
              s = s + b+";";
             }catch(Exception e){
              e.printStackTrace();
             }finally {

             }
            }
           
            //System.out.println("b = "+b + " s = "+ s);
            System.out.println(System.currentTimeMillis()-ii);
           
         double c = 0;
         String ss = "";
         long iii = System.currentTimeMillis();
            for(int i = 0; i<20000;i++) {
              c = StrictMath.pow(c+i, 1.0/3);
              ss = ss + c+";";
            }
           
            //System.out.println("b = "+c + " ss = "+ ss);
            System.out.println(System.currentTimeMillis()-iii);
           
        }
    }

  • 相关阅读:
    vector存入共享内存(了解)
    vector内存分配
    关于传值的小问题
    c++11 lambda(匿名函数)
    std::function,std::bind复习
    项目分析(人物上线消息)
    mongo 1067错误
    随笔1
    随笔
    交换机的体系结构和各部件说明
  • 原文地址:https://www.cnblogs.com/flying607/p/3416015.html
Copyright © 2011-2022 走看看